Transaction 67e33d5c52bbe5e8bb31d307b4ed30418eb6ebbd212c80fa17f0b7857cfafe6a
1 Input
1 Output
-
67e33d5c52bbe5e8bb31d307b4ed30418eb6ebbd212c80fa17f0b7857cfafe6a:0
- value
- 21658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a9fbca22dd244260645e073c69bd5a6261ec5e6 OP_EQUAL
- address
- 3HFC9sAr6U5LSjb6ZRbW5emcphENzdre5R